301重定向是什么意思?
301重定向是什么意思?我现在为了做地方导航站特地买了一个套装域名:www.qjabc.com和www.qjabc.cn但朋友说这2个域名不能同时使用,怕百度不喜欢,让我...
301重定向是什么意思?我现在为了做地方导航站特地买了一个套装域名:www.qjabc.com和www.qjabc.cn 但朋友说这2个域名不能同时使用,怕百度不喜欢,让我做一个301,可我在百度上查找了一下301还是没看懂,所以问问大家这2个域名是不是真的必须做301重定向啊?
展开
1个回答
展开全部
就是将一个域名跳转到另外一个域名 ,其中一个页面看不到 比如说要从cn的跳到com的 那么当访问cn域名的时候就会直接跳转到com域名
给你几个重定向的代码和方法 方法直接应用就可以 代码需要放到所有页面的里边 最好是头部
1、IIS服务器实现301重定向(需要系统支持方可)
* 打开internet信息服务管理器,在欲重定向的网页或目录上按右键
* 选择“重定向到URL”
* 在“重定向到”输入框中输入要跳转到的目标网页的URL地址
* 选中“资源的永久重定向”(切记)
* 最后点击“应用”
2、Apache服务器实现301重定向
相比较来说,Apache实现起来要比IIS简单多了。在Apache中,有个很重要的文件.htaccess,通过对它的设置,可以实现很多强大的功能,301重定向只是其中之一。
redirect permanent /index.php http://www.domain.com/index.php?go=category_6(将网页index.php重定向到http://www.domain.com/index.php?go=category_6)
通过合理地配置重定向参数中的正则表达式,可以实现更复杂的匹配。具体可参考Apache手册。
3、PHP下的301重定向
<?
Header( "HTTP/1.1 301 Moved Permanently" ) ;
Header( "Location: http://www.domain.com" );
?
4、ASP下的301重定向
<%@ Language=VBScript %>
<%
Response.Status="301 Moved Permanently"
Response.AddHeader "Location","http://www.domain.com"
%>
5、ASP .NET下的301重定向
<script runat="server">
private void Page_Load(object sender, System.EventArgs e)
{
Response.Status = "301 Moved Permanently";
Response.AddHeader ("Location","http://www.domain.com");
}
</script>
自己研究下吧
给你几个重定向的代码和方法 方法直接应用就可以 代码需要放到所有页面的里边 最好是头部
1、IIS服务器实现301重定向(需要系统支持方可)
* 打开internet信息服务管理器,在欲重定向的网页或目录上按右键
* 选择“重定向到URL”
* 在“重定向到”输入框中输入要跳转到的目标网页的URL地址
* 选中“资源的永久重定向”(切记)
* 最后点击“应用”
2、Apache服务器实现301重定向
相比较来说,Apache实现起来要比IIS简单多了。在Apache中,有个很重要的文件.htaccess,通过对它的设置,可以实现很多强大的功能,301重定向只是其中之一。
redirect permanent /index.php http://www.domain.com/index.php?go=category_6(将网页index.php重定向到http://www.domain.com/index.php?go=category_6)
通过合理地配置重定向参数中的正则表达式,可以实现更复杂的匹配。具体可参考Apache手册。
3、PHP下的301重定向
<?
Header( "HTTP/1.1 301 Moved Permanently" ) ;
Header( "Location: http://www.domain.com" );
?
4、ASP下的301重定向
<%@ Language=VBScript %>
<%
Response.Status="301 Moved Permanently"
Response.AddHeader "Location","http://www.domain.com"
%>
5、ASP .NET下的301重定向
<script runat="server">
private void Page_Load(object sender, System.EventArgs e)
{
Response.Status = "301 Moved Permanently";
Response.AddHeader ("Location","http://www.domain.com");
}
</script>
自己研究下吧
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询